East Rindge
East Rindge is a locality in Town of Rindge, Cheshire County, New Hampshire. East Rindge is situated nearby to the hamlet Converseville, as well as near Cutter Hill.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Pratt Mountain
Peak
Photo: Wikimedia, Public domain.
Pratt Mountain is a 1,817 feet summit within the Wapack Range of mountains in south-central New Hampshire, United States. It is situated within the town of New Ipswich, and is traversed by the 22 mi Wapack Trail. Pratt Mountain is situated 2½ miles east of East Rindge.
Hampshire Country School
School
Hampshire Country School is a private boarding school for Twice Exceptional children in Rindge, New Hampshire, United States, founded by Henry Curtis Patey and Adelaide Walker Patey in 1948.

Rindge
Photo: Carju451, Public domain.
Rindge is a town in Cheshire County, New Hampshire, United States. The population was 6,476 at the 2020 census, up from 6,014 at the 2010 census. Rindge is home to Franklin Pierce University, the Cathedral of the Pines and part of Annett State Forest.
New Ipswich
Village
Photo: Wikimedia, Public domain.
New Ipswich is a town in Hillsborough County, New Hampshire, United States. The population was 5,204 at the 2020 census. New Ipswich, situated on the Massachusetts border, includes the villages of Bank, Davis, Gibson Four Corners, Highbridge, New Ipswich Center, Smithville, and Wilder, though these village designations no longer hold the importance they did in the past. New Ipswich is situated 6 miles east of East Rindge.
Winchendon
Town
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Winchendon, nicknamed Toy Town, is a town in Worcester County, Massachusetts, United States. The population was 10,364 at the 2020 census. The town includes the villages of Waterville and Winchendon Springs. Winchendon is situated 6 miles southwest of East Rindge.
